Isayensi Engemuva Kwama-Dry Type Transformers: Umhlahlandlela Ophelele

Isayensi Engemuva Kwama-Dry Type Transformers: Umhlahlandlela Ophelele

Isingeniso

Ama-transformer ayizinto ezibalulekile ezivame ukusetshenziswa ezinhlelweni zikagesi ukudlulisa ugesi phakathi kwamasekethe. Phakathi kwezinhlobo ezahlukene ezitholakalayo, ama-transformer ohlobo olomile athola ukuthandwa ngenxa yokuphepha kwawo, ukusebenza kahle, kanye nobungane bemvelo. Kulesi siqondisi esiphelele, sizohlola isayensi ngemuva kwama-transformer ohlobo olomile futhi sihlole izimiso zawo zokusebenza, izinzuzo, ukusetshenziswa, kanye nezidingo zokugcinwa.

I. Ziyini i-Dry Type Transformers?

A. Incazelo kanye nokwakhiwa

Ama-transformer ohlobo olomile, aziwa nangokuthi ama-transformer e-cast resin, angamadivayisi kagesi asebenzisa umoya njengendawo yokupholisa esikhundleni samafutha. Ngokungafani nama-transformer agcwele uwoyela, ama-transformer ohlobo olomile asebenzisa i-epoxy resin noma i-cast resin ukuvikela ama-windings. Lokhu kwakhiwa kuwenza azicime futhi kunikeza ukumelana okungcono namaphutha angaphakathi, okuqinisekisa amazinga aphezulu okuphepha.

B. Isimiso Sokusebenza

Ama-transformer ohlobo olomile asebenza ngesimiso sokungeniswa kwe-electromagnetic. Lapho i-alternating current (AC) igeleza nge-primary winding, idala insimu yamagnetic ehlukahlukene ebangela i-voltage ekujikeni kwesibili. Ama-primary windings kanye ne-secondary windings ahlukaniswe ngokomzimba, okuvimbela noma yikuphi ukuxhumana okuqondile phakathi kwama-windings nokuqinisekisa ukufudumala.

II. Izinzuzo zama-Transformer ohlobo olomile

A. Ukuphepha

Njengoba kushiwo ngaphambili, ama-transformer ohlobo olomile anikeza ukuphepha okuthuthukisiwe ngenxa yezakhiwo zawo zokuzicisha. Uma kwenzeka amaphutha angaphakathi, njengezifunda ezimfushane, i-resin esetshenziselwa ukuvikela igesi ivimbela ukusabalala komlilo. Ngaphezu kwalokho, ukungabikho kwamafutha avuthayo kususa ingozi yokuvuza kwamafutha noma ukuqhuma, okwenza ama-transformer ohlobo olomile afaneleke kakhulu ekufakweni kwangaphakathi.

B. Ubungane Emvelweni

Ukusetshenziswa kwe-epoxy resin kuma-transformer ohlobo olomile kuwenza abe nobungane nemvelo. I-resin ayinabo ubuthi, ayibeki izingozi empilweni, futhi ingaphinde isetshenziswe kalula. Ngaphezu kwalokho, njengoba ingadingi uwoyela, ukulahlwa kwezinto eziyingozi kuyagwenywa, okunciphisa umthelela wemvelo wama-transformer.

C. Ukusebenza kahle

Ama-transformer ohlobo olomile abonisa ukusebenza kahle kakhulu kokushisa futhi asebenza kahle kakhulu. Ukufakwa kwe-cast resin kususa ukushisa ngempumelelo, okuvumela ukuphuma kwamandla aphezulu ngaphandle kokubeka engcupheni ukuphepha. Ngaphezu kwalokho, ukungabikho kwamafutha kwenza inqubo yokupholisa ibe lula futhi kunciphisa ukulahleka kwamandla, okuholela ekusebenzeni kahle okukhulu kanye nokonga izindleko.

III. Ukusetshenziswa Kweziguquli Zohlobo Olomile

A. Izakhiwo Zezentengiselwano

Ama-transformer ohlobo olomile athola ukusetshenziswa okubanzi ezakhiweni zezentengiselwano, okuhlanganisa amahhovisi, izitolo ezinkulu, kanye nezikhumulo zezindiza. Umklamo omncane wama-transformer kanye namazinga aphansi omsindo kuwenza afaneleke ukufakwa ngaphakathi ezindaweni ezinabantu abaningi lapho indawo ethule ibalulekile khona.

B. Izikhungo Zemfundo

Izikole, amanyuvesi, nezikhungo zocwaningo zivame ukusebenzisa ama-transformer ohlobo olomile ngenxa yezici zawo zokuphepha. Ukungabikho kwamafutha avuthayo kunciphisa ingozi yezingozi, okwenza afaneleke ezikhungweni zemfundo lapho ukuvikelwa kwabafundi nothisha kubaluleke kakhulu.

C. Izilungiselelo Zezimboni

Ama-transformer ohlobo olomile avame ukusetshenziswa ezindaweni zezimboni, njengezindawo zokukhiqiza kanye nezitshalo zamakhemikhali. Ama-transformer angamelana nezimo ezinzima, okuhlanganisa ukushintshashintsha kwezinga lokushisa, umswakama, kanye nokuchayeka kumakhemikhali. Ukwakhiwa okuqinile kuqinisekisa ukuthembeka nokusebenza okuqhubekayo ekusetshenzisweni kwezimboni okudingakalayo.

IV. Ukugcinwa Kwama-Transformer Ohlobo Olomile

A. Ukuhlolwa Kokumelana Nokushiswa Kwesikhathi Esithile

Ukuhlolwa okuvamile kokumelana nokufakwa kokushisa kubalulekile ukuze kutholakale noma yikuphi ukuwohloka noma ukungena komswakama ohlelweni lokufakwa kokushisa. Ukwenza lezi zivivinyo minyaka yonke kusiza ukuqinisekisa ukuthi ukufakwa kokushisa kwama-transformer kuhlala kuphelele futhi kugweme ukuwohloka ngokuhamba kwesikhathi.

B. Ukuhlanza Nokuhlola Okubonakalayo

Ukuhlanza njalo izindawo ze-transformer, izindawo zokupholisa umoya, kanye nangaphakathi kwendawo ebiyelwe kubalulekile ukuvimbela ukunqwabelana kothuli nokugcina ukupholisa okuhle. Ngaphezu kwalokho, ukuhlola okubonakalayo kuvumela ukuhlonza noma yiziphi izimpawu zomonakalo, ukuxhumeka okuxekethile, noma ukushisa ngokweqile.

C. Ukuqapha Nokuhlaziya

Ukusebenzisa izinhlelo zokuqapha ezithuthukisiwe ukukala nokuqopha amapharamitha ahlukahlukene, njengokushisa, ugesi, kanye ne-voltage, kusiza ekutholeni izinto ezingavamile kanye nezinkinga ezingaba khona ngendlela efanele. Ukuhlaziywa kwedatha kusiza ukuthuthukisa ukusebenza, ukuvimbela ukwehluleka, kanye nokwandisa isikhathi sokusebenza sama-transformer.

Kungani insimbi engaphakathi ye-transformer kufanele isekelwe phansi?
1. Kungani insimbi engaphakathi ye-transformer kufanele isekelwe phansi?
Ukufakwa kwesisekelo se-transformer core kuhloselwe ukuphepha kanye nokuhambisana kwe-electromagnetic.


Ngakolunye uhlangothi, ukumisa isisekelo se-transformer kuvimbela ama-voltage okuxhumana abangelwa amaphutha omhlaba, okungaba yingozi enkulu kubantu. Ngoba lapho kwenzeka iphutha lomhlabathi kolunye uhlangothi lwe-transformer, isisekelo sensimbi kolunye uhlangothi singase sibe ne-voltage ethinta umhlabathi. Uma ingamiswanga, le voltage ayikwazi ukukhishwa.


Ngakolunye uhlangothi, ukumisa isisekelo se-transformer kunganciphisa nokuphazamiseka kwemisebe kagesi, ikakhulukazi kwemishini yomsakazo nezinhlelo zokuxhumana. Lokhu kungenxa yokuthi ugesi uzokhiqiza insimu yamagnetic enkabeni yensimbi. Uma isisekelo sensimbi singamiswanga, le nsimu yamagnetic ingavuza endaweni ezungezile futhi iphazamise ukusebenza okuvamile kweminye imishini.


Ekuphetheni, ukusekela i-transformer core kuyindlela yokuvikela ezingozini zokushaqeka kanye nokuphazamiseka kwe-electromagnetic.

Uyini Umugqa Wokusika Ubude?
Umugqa onqunyiwe ubude uwumshini okhethekile osetshenziswa embonini yokucubungula insimbi. Uguqula ama-coil amakhulu ensimbi abe ubude obuthile, okunikeza izinga eliphezulu lokunemba nokusebenza kahle. Le migqa ibalulekile ekuguquleni izinto zokusetshenziswa zibe yizingxenye ezisebenzisekayo ezimbonini ezahlukahlukene.
